Inside Edition profiled Charles Graves in a holiday segment that highlighted what changes for Deaf children when Santa signs back. The syndicated newsmagazine captured several family encounters, including one in which a Deaf girl approached Graves clearly bracing for an interpreter — and then realized, mid-greeting, that no interpreter was needed.
The show’s reach into millions of American homes through syndication helped surface the foundation’s work to general audiences who might not encounter Deaf-cultural news otherwise. Inside Edition’s framing emphasized the simple, human dimension of the story: a man who looks like Santa, who happens to be Deaf, who happens to be very good at making children feel seen.
The segment is part of the 2022–2023 cluster of national coverage that built the audience the documentary would later draw on.
